腾讯 – 软件开发-前端开发方向 职位分析和面试指导

职位简介:

作为腾讯前端开发工程师,你将负责Web页面、小程序及跨平台框架的研发工作,通过技术方案优化提升产品体验,抽离通用组件提升开发效率,并持续探索前沿技术。该职位要求计算机相关专业本科及以上学历(非相关专业需自修计算机必修课),需要你热爱编程并具备丰富实战经验,熟练掌握JS/TS/HTML/CSS等前端技术,了解至少一门后端技术如JSP/python/php/Node.js,熟悉常见前端框架及devops工具,掌握web/app/小程序前后端架构,具备算法能力和网络协议知识。工作地点可选择深圳总部或北京、上海、广州。

>> 在腾讯官网查看完整职位详情。

简历及面试建议:

在准备腾讯前端开发岗位的简历时,你需要特别突出几个关键点。首先,技术栈的全面性很重要,不仅要展示你对JS/TS/HTML/CSS的熟练掌握,更要体现你对至少一门后端技术的了解,这是腾讯特别看重的全栈能力。其次,项目经验部分应该着重描述你参与过的Web、小程序或跨平台项目,特别是那些你主导过技术优化或组件复用的案例,用具体数据说明你的贡献,比如’通过组件化开发提升团队效率30%’这样的量化成果。对于应届生或转行者,可以强调自学能力和计算机基础,比如列出你自修的计算机专业课程或参与的编程竞赛。简历中还应体现你对前沿技术的关注,比如你研究过的新框架或工具,这能展示你与技术要求的匹配度。最后,别忘了提及你的算法能力和网络知识,这些都是腾讯面试中常考的重点。

腾讯的前端开发面试通常会从技术深度和广度两个维度进行考察。技术面可能会涉及算法题、网络协议原理等基础知识,建议提前复习常见算法如排序、查找等,并深入理解HTTP/HTTPS、TCP/IP等协议。面试官很可能会询问你过去项目中遇到的技术挑战和解决方案,准备2-3个能体现你问题解决能力和技术深度的案例,最好能结合腾讯的业务场景,比如小程序性能优化、跨平台兼容性处理等。系统设计环节可能会考察你对前后端架构的理解,要能清晰地阐述一个完整系统的设计思路。行为面试部分,腾讯注重候选人的技术热情和学习能力,可以准备一些展示你主动学习新技术、解决复杂问题的故事。面试中保持自信但谦逊的态度,遇到不会的问题可以坦诚说明但展示解决问题的思路,这往往比直接给出答案更重要。

在线咨询

提示:由 AI 生成回答,可能存在错误,请注意甄别。